AN ACT CONCERNING THE STATE'S BOTTLE BILL.
This bill requires the creation of a nonprofit beverage container stewardship organization that will manage the state's bottle deposit program. The organization must be run by deposit initiators, operate as a tax-exempt entity, and demonstrate strong financial controls to prevent fraud. Companies selling beverage containers must join this organization within three months of its approval, and the organization must develop a detailed plan to achieve an 80% redemption rate while ensuring financial self-sustainability. The plan must include input from various stakeholders and outline how recovered materials will be recycled, with annual reports submitted to the commissioner to track compliance.
